Definition

1. Fire : A slow combustion that significant without overpressure


2. Explosion : A release of energy that causes a blast

3. Flammability Limit : The minimum (lower,LFL) and maximum concentration of combustible vapor in air that will propagate a flame

(source : Guidelines CPQRA, AIChE, 2000)

Understanding Fire and Explosion


Physical Properties Key Factor of Flammable 1. 2. 3. 4. 5. 6. 7. 8. 9. Boiling Point Vapor Pressure Flash Point Autoignition Enthalphy of Combustion (Hc) MIE Density Conductivity of material Size of material

Understanding Fire and Explosion


Environmental Properties Key Factor of Fire /Explosion 1. Operational Parameter (Pressure, Flowrate, Temp, etc) 2. Lay-out of unit process/equipment 3. Installation (congested, confined, etc)

4. Source of heat (open fire, conductive heat, static electric, etc)


5. Meteorogical condition (Wind speed, direction, etc) 6. Leakage dimension (bore, rupture, hole, etc)

Understanding Fire and Explosion


Impact of Fire & Explosion 1. Breakage the molecular bond 2. Heat Flux / Heat Radition 3. Poisonous Gas

4. Blast Wave/Shock Wave


5. Debris trajectory/projectile

Selection safeguard for Fire and Explosion s Risk Control


Prevention Barrier 1. Inherently Safe Practice Principles Minimize: Reducing the amount of hazardous material present at any one time Substitute: Replacing one material with another of less hazard Moderate: Reducing the strength of an effect Simplify: Designing out problems rather than adding additional equipment or features to deal with them 2. Engineering consideration Hazardous Area Zone Classification (IEC/EN 60079, NFPA 479, API 500) Heating Venting Air Circulation (HVAC) system Electric Static Discharge (ESD) system Maximum Allowable Working Pressure (MAWP) Design Emergency Shut Down Valve (ESDV) System Lay-out facility (lokasi, jarak, dll) Mechanical Protection (Material, Coating, dll) Inerting System

Selection safeguard for Fire and Explosion s Risk Control


Prevention Barrier 3. Operation Consideration Preventive Maintenance Program (inspeksi rutin, testing peralatan, dll) Standard Operating Procedure (SOP) (operating parameter controlling, alarm system, dll) Housekeeping Kompetensi Personel Implementasi Sistem Manajemen Pengendalian Kerugian (Manajemen resiko) Permit System Storage and handling management system Cooling system (Deluge water system, vessel cooling system, dll) Accident Investigation and Lesson Learned Electrical Connection System (Lighting Protection, Grounding, dll)

Selection safeguard for Fire and Explosion s Risk Control


Mitigation Barrier 1. Engineering Consideration Hydrant & Sprinkle System Purging system (PSV, Rupture Disc, Flare System, dll) Dikes Network Water Curtain System CO2/Inert Gas Suppression System Blast-Wall

Selection safeguard for Fire and Explosion s Risk Control


Mitigation Barrier 2. Operation Consideration Fire Extinghuisers (APAR) Foam system Emergency Response Plan (assembly area) Personal Protective Equipment (APD) Community Emergency Response
